Story summary
- A Yale study reveals that forest-based agroforestry (FAF) is a powerful ally in the fight against climate change, rivaling traditional tree planting. By boosting forest health, biodiversity, and carbon storage, FAF not only nurtures the environment but also uplifts local economies. The research calls for policymakers to prioritize sustainable FAF practices and enhance funding for diverse agroforestry systems, showcasing the transformative power of human stewardship in forest management.
